Default How do I highlight a cell when a date is overdue?

Hi,
I was wondering if anyone could help provide the formula required to
highlight a cell when a return date is overdue.
Column L is the date sent and column M is the date returned. I want to
highlight the cells in column L if the corresponding cell in column M is
still blank after 14 days.
